  • Patent number: 9974126
    Abstract: A control system for an electrical load, which control system is intended to receive a voltage supplied by a mains electricity supply and includes a control switch, which is designed to take an open state or a closed state, a signalling indicator connected in parallel with the switch and designed to take two different states that are each linked to the open state or the closed state of the switch, a control device connected to the signalling indicator and designed to limit a voltage on the terminals of the electrical load below a threshold value when the switch is in the open state.

  • Patent number: 8159806
    Abstract: A bistable electromagnetic actuator comprising a magnetic circuit comprising a magnetic yoke in which a shunt extends perpendicularly to a longitudinal axis of said yoke and comprising a permanent magnet positioned between a first surface of the yoke and the shunt. A plunger core is fitted with axial sliding between a latched position and an unlatched position. A coil extending between the shunt and a second surface of the yoke is designed to generate a first magnetic control flux to move the plunger core from an unlatched position to a latched position. A second magnetic control flux enables the plunger core to move from the latched position to the unlatched position by the action of a return spring.

  • Patent number: 6861785
    Abstract: The invention concerns a self-powered remote control device comprising transmitting means, a feeder circuit connected to said transmitting means, a generator supplying electric power connected to the feeder circuit, and control means associated with the electric power generator. The generator comprises at least a piezoelectric element receiving mechanical stresses produced by actuating the control means and supplying electric power to the feeder circuit. The invention also concerns an apparatus comprising at least a self-contained control device actuated by a mechanical action member. The invention further concerns an electric installation comprising means for receiving signals transmitted by at least a self-powered control device.
